Picnic needs £5 million public liability insurance
Posted on July 22nd 2009
Local event organiser, Ian Blackwell, has just been asked to organise public liability insurance for over £5 million for one of Britain's most archetypal and dignified trademarks - the picnic! As part of the Eden projects, 'The Big Lunch', Blackwell wished to stage a simple picnic for the local community and to encourage interaction between neighbours. However, the local council told Blackwell that should he wish to have this picnic he will have to secure public liability insurance for the event to go ahead.
The event organiser dutifully rang up his insurance providers in order to secure cover, who were equally as baffled as Blackwell, considering the picnic to be a 'low' risk; eventually, cover was secured for the premium of £70.
However as Totnes Town Council in Devon explained the insurance was to cover the event organiser should any misfortunate accidents occur; Blackwell on the other hand found it hard to imagine what accidents could transpire as no particularly treacherous activities had been planned. "The worst" he imagined, "that could happen, would be someone choking on a chicken bone or being stung by a wasp."
To add to the dubious liability insurance request, Blackwell had checked that should the picnic of been a birthday party in the park, individuals would have been responsible for their own actions.
